The Sr. Product Marketing Manager is responsible for leading commercial marketing efforts for Radiometer’s portfolio of blood gas analyzers and sampling accessories. This role is critical to driving product adoption, generating new leads, and enabling sales teams with tools that accelerate opportunity conversion across North America.
In This Role, You Will Have The Opportunity To
Develop and execute marketing strategies to increase the adoption of instruments and sampling accessories.
Design sales tools and messaging frameworks that support positioning and objection handling.
Create digital content and nurture campaigns to support leads throughout the sales funnel.
The Essential Requirements Of The Job Include
Bachelor’s degree in Biology, Chemistry, Engineering, or a related scientific field MBA would be a plus
5+ years of experience in the healthcare industry
Strong knowledge of clinical workflows in ICU, ED, or laboratory environments
Proven experience selling or marketing capital equipment and accessories to hospitals, including knowledge of procurement and sales processes
Experience in using digital marketing tools (e.g., HubSpot, Marketo) to generate and nurture leads and executing Account-Based Marketing campaigns across key hospital accounts
